On the island of Oahu, you can watch the world-class surfers face the big waves on the North Shore. Watch for the spouting of a humpback whale, migrating close to the shoreline or tee off at a championship golf course. Sunbathe all day on the North Shore and dance the night away in Waikiki. You won’t want to skip a visit to the USS Arizona Memorial at Pearl Harbor. It’s quite a sight to see.
As is, watching the sunrise atop the 10,000-foot Haleakala Crater on the Island of Maui. Don’t miss it or a drive up the scenic, 53-mile Hana highway.
Water activities are plentiful on Maui from snorkeling to scuba diving and para-sailing. A catered meal aboard a catamaran on the crystal blue waters off the island of Maui is sure to impress.
On Kauai, experience a helicopter ride along the 3000-foot cliffs of the Napali coast or kayak down the only navigable rivers in Hawaii. Hike up Waimea Canyon for stunning views of the “Grand Canyon of the Pacific”.
